Yeti and Tottenham Hotspur announce licensing deal
Yeti has agreed on a three-year licensing agreement with Tottenham Hotspur, the London-based football club also referred to as Tottenham or Spurs, that competes in England’s Premier League. Analysis: Sales per employee increased 18% in 2021
Aggregate, year-over-year employee growth at 19 sporting goods companies rose 9.7 percent in 2021 as average sales per employee (SPE) at these firms increased 18.4 percent to €390,000. American Yeti will open a European subsidiary
Yeti Coolers, a wholly owned subsidiary of Yeti Holdings headquartered in Austin, Texas, has announced that it is planning to set up a European office in Amsterdam.
